Option (d):
When there is a change in the disposable income of households, there will be changes in the consumption pattern of a consumer. When the disposable income increases, it increases the quantity demanded and when the disposable income decreases, it decreases the quantity demanded. This means that there will be a movement along the same consumption function and there will be no shift in the consumption function. Hence, option 'd' is correct.

Option (b):
The interest rate determines the consumption function of an individual. When the rate of interest is higher, consumers will consume less and save more and vice versa. Thus, the changes in the interest rate of the economy shift the consumption function. Hence, option 'b' is incorrect.
